About agriculture in Nejo

Nejo is situated in the Oromia Region of western Ethiopia, set amidst a landscape characterized by rolling hills and transitional highlands. The surrounding rural area is part of a fertile ecological zone that bridges the gap between the higher plateaus and lower valley plains, offering varied terrain that supports diverse vegetation.

Agricultural production in this part of Oromia is primarily centered on mixed farming systems. Farmers here traditionally cultivate crops such as maize, teff, and various pulses, while coffee often grows in the shade of the area's wooded landscapes. Livestock rearing, including cattle and small ruminants, forms an essential component of the local economy and household livelihoods.

For agronomists and seasonal workers, the region experiences distinct agricultural cycles dictated by the rainy seasons. Demand for labor typically peaks during planting and harvesting phases. Professionals arriving in Nejo should be prepared for rural working conditions, focusing on improving crop yields through sustainable practices or assisting in the management of local cooperative farms.
